1. The Federal Reserve System serves several functions. One important function is monetary policy. Through this function, the Federal Reserve controls interest rates and the money supply to manage economic growth and stabilize inflation. For example, during an economic downturn, the Federal Reserve may lower interest rates to stimulate borrowing and spending, thus aiding economic recovery.
Another function is bank supervision and regulation. The Federal Reserve oversees banks to ensure they operate safely and soundly. This includes conducting regular examinations, setting capital requirements, and implementing regulations to protect consumers. For instance, the Federal Reserve may enforce rules to prevent excessive risk-taking by banks, which helps maintain the stability of the financial system.
The Federal Reserve also plays a role in maintaining financial system stability. It monitors and addresses risks that could potentially disrupt the functioning of the financial system. For instance, during times of financial stress, the Federal Reserve may provide liquidity support to banks to prevent a systemic crisis and maintain the smooth functioning of the payment and settlement systems.
2. The Federal Reserve's independence is a subject of discussion. Proponents argue that independence allows the Federal Reserve to make decisions based on economic considerations rather than political pressures. This enhances credibility and promotes effective monetary policy implementation. It also helps insulate central bankers from short-term political influences, enabling them to focus on long-term economic goals. Additionally, independence can provide market stability by reducing uncertainty about monetary policy decisions.
Critics of Federal Reserve independence argue that it may lead to a lack of democratic accountability. They believe that important decisions about interest rates and the economy should be subject to public debate and oversight. Some argue that political representatives should have a more direct role in shaping monetary policy, as it affects the livelihoods of citizens. However, proponents of independence contend that central bank autonomy allows for more objective and impartial decision-making, reducing the risk of short-term political considerations negatively impacting long-term economic stability.

Utility is the satisfaction individuals derive from consuming goods or services. It is subjective and cannot be directly measured or compared across individuals.
Utility is a concept used in economics to describe the level of satisfaction or happiness individuals derive from consuming goods or services. It is a subjective measure that varies from person to person based on their preferences, tastes, and individual circumstances. Since utility is a subjective experience, it cannot be directly observed or quantified.
Individuals can indirectly measure their own utility by making choices and expressing preferences among different options. For example, if a person consistently chooses one product over another, it implies that they derive more utility from the chosen product. However, this measurement is relative and based on personal comparisons rather than an absolute scale.
Measuring utility across individuals is challenging because utility is subjective and varies from person to person. What brings satisfaction to one individual may not bring the same level of satisfaction to another. Therefore, it is difficult for someone else to accurately measure an individual's utility.
When it comes to measuring social welfare or aggregating individuals' utilities, adding up peoples' utilities is not a reliable method. Utility is not a quantifiable or directly comparable measure across individuals.
Additionally, it neglects other important factors such as income distribution, equity considerations, and externalities that impact overall welfare. Instead, policymakers use various tools such as cost-benefit analysis, surveys, and social indicators to estimate the welfare implications of government policies.

When entering into a partnership agreement with international partners, companies may use various types of legal agreements, including joint venture agreements, partnership agreements, and distribution agreements.
These agreements outline the terms and conditions of the partnership, including responsibilities, profit sharing, and dispute resolution. Letters of Intent (LOIs) and Memoranda of Understanding (MOUs) play a crucial role in binding these agreements by establishing the intent to enter into a formal partnership and outlining the key terms before the final agreement is drafted.
When forming partnerships with international partners, companies may choose different types of legal agreements based on the nature of the partnership. Joint venture agreements are common when two or more companies collaborate to establish a new business entity. Partnership agreements outline the terms of a general partnership, where partners share profits, losses, and responsibilities. Distribution agreements are used when one party grants another the right to distribute its products or services in a specific region.
Letters of Intent (LOIs) and Memoranda of Understanding (MOUs) are important in binding these partnership agreements. LOIs are typically used in the early stages of negotiations and express the intent of the parties to proceed with the partnership. They outline the key terms and conditions that will be incorporated into the final agreement. MOUs, on the other hand, are more detailed and formal than LOIs. They establish a preliminary understanding between the parties and outline specific terms, such as financial arrangements, intellectual property rights, and dispute resolution mechanisms.
The importance of LOIs and MOUs lies in their ability to provide a framework for negotiations and establish the intent of the parties involved. While they are not legally binding in the same way as a final agreement, they create a sense of commitment and serve as a starting point for drafting the formal partnership agreement. LOIs and MOUs help to clarify the expectations and obligations of the parties, ensure alignment on key terms, and minimize the risk of misunderstandings during the negotiation process. They provide a roadmap for the final agreement, allowing both parties to move forward with confidence while the legal documentation is being prepared.

The Paris Agreement is an international treaty aimed at combating climate change by reducing greenhouse gas emissions. Australia's commitment under the Paris Agreement includes setting a target to reduce emissions by 26-28% below 2005 levels by 2030.
The Paris Agreement is a landmark international treaty that was adopted in 2015 during the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change (UNFCCC) Conference of the Parties (COP 21) in Paris, France. Its main objective is to limit global warming to well below 2 degrees Celsius above pre-industrial levels and to pursue efforts to limit the temperature increase to 1.5 degrees Celsius.
Under the Paris Agreement, each participating country is required to submit their own nationally determined contributions (NDCs) outlining their efforts to mitigate greenhouse gas emissions. These contributions are intended to be ambitious and progressive over time, with the goal of collectively reducing global emissions.
Australia, as a signatory to the Paris Agreement, has committed to reducing its greenhouse gas emissions by 26-28% below 2005 levels by the year 2030. This reduction target reflects Australia's effort to address climate change and contribute to the global climate mitigation goals.
To achieve its emissions reduction target, Australia has implemented various measures and policies, including the Emissions Reduction Fund, which provides financial incentives for projects that reduce emissions, and the Renewable Energy Target, which aims to increase the share of renewable energy in Australia's electricity generation. Additionally, Australia has been working to transition to a low-carbon economy by promoting energy efficiency, investing in renewable energy technologies, and supporting research and innovation in clean energy.

(a) When the interest rate falls, it stimulates borrowing and investment, leading to an increase in aggregate demand (AD). As a result, both price levels and real GDP will rise. The increase in aggregate demand will lead to upward pressure on prices, causing inflation to increase. With increased investment and economic activity, unemployment is likely to decrease as businesses expand and create more job opportunities.
(b) If the wage rate temporarily falls, businesses' production costs decrease, leading to a decrease in their marginal cost (MC) and an increase in short-run aggregate supply (SRAS). As a result, both price levels and real GDP will increase. With lower production costs, businesses can lower their prices, which can lead to a decrease in inflation. However, the impact on unemployment depends on the elasticity of labor supply. If the wage decrease leads to a significant increase in labor supply, it could lead to an increase in employment and a decrease in unemployment.
(c) When the dollar appreciates relative to foreign currencies, it makes imports relatively cheaper and exports relatively more expensive. This leads to a decrease in net exports, reducing aggregate demand (AD). As a result, both price levels and real GDP will decrease. With decreased aggregate demand, inflation is likely to decrease. The decrease in economic activity can also lead to an increase in unemployment as businesses may reduce production and cut jobs.
(d) If businesses temporarily expect higher resource prices in the future, it can lead to an increase in their costs of production. This will result in a decrease in short-run aggregate supply (SRAS), leading to higher price levels and lower real GDP. With higher production costs, businesses may pass on the cost increases to consumers, leading to higher inflation. The impact on unemployment depends on the extent to which businesses adjust their production and hiring plans in response to the expected higher resource prices.
(e) When business taxes rise, it increases the cost of production for businesses. This leads to a decrease in short-run aggregate supply (SRAS), causing price levels to increase and real GDP to decrease. Higher production costs can lead to higher inflation as businesses pass on the tax burden to consumers. The increase in production costs may also result in businesses reducing their output and cutting jobs, leading to an increase in unemployment.
It's important to note that these are simplified explanations and the actual impact of these factors can be influenced by various other economic conditions and factors. Additionally, the magnitude and duration of the effects can vary depending on the specific circumstances and the overall state of the economy.

2. Public Relations as a Method of Marketing Communication:
Public relations (PR) is a strategic communication process that builds mutually beneficial relationships between an organization and its various stakeholders, including the public, media, customers, employees, and investors. It involves managing the company's reputation, shaping public perception, and fostering positive relationships with key audiences.
PR can be used as a form of product and service promotion by:
a) Generating Positive Publicity: PR professionals work to secure media coverage and positive publicity for the company and its products/services. This can be achieved through press releases, media pitches, feature stories, interviews, and other PR tactics. Positive media coverage helps increase brand visibility, credibility, and product/service awareness among the target audience.
b) Influencer Partnerships: PR teams often collaborate with influencers or industry experts to promote the company's products or services. By leveraging the influence and reach of these individuals, the company can gain access to their followers and tap into their trust and credibility.
c) Thought Leadership and Expertise: PR efforts can position company executives or subject matter experts as thought leaders in their industry. By sharing valuable insights, expertise, and industry trends through media interviews, articles, or speaking engagements, the company can enhance its reputation and establish itself as a trusted authority.
d) Crisis Management: PR plays a crucial role in managing and mitigating crises that may arise in the company. Effective communication strategies can help address concerns, provide accurate information, and rebuild trust among stakeholders in times of crisis, thus protecting the company's brand and reputation.
e) Community Engagement: PR initiatives can involve community engagement activities such as sponsorships, corporate social responsibility (CSR) programs, or partnerships with nonprofit organizations. These efforts not only contribute to the well-being of the community but also enhance the company's reputation and promote its products/services as socially responsible.

The difference between gross and fine motor skills is whether they involve bigger or smaller muscles.
Gross motor skills refer to the ability to control and coordinate large muscle groups to perform movements such as walking, running, jumping, and throwing. These skills involve the use of larger muscle groups and the coordination of multiple body parts.
On the other hand, fine motor skills involve the coordination and control of smaller muscle groups, particularly those in the hands and fingers. These skills are necessary for activities that require precise movements, such as writing, drawing, typing, or using utensils. Fine motor skills are essential for tasks that require dexterity, hand-eye coordination, and precision.
The distinction between gross and fine motor skills is primarily based on the size and complexity of the muscle groups involved in the movement. Gross motor skills focus on larger muscle groups and movements, while fine motor skills involve smaller muscle groups and more precise movements. Both types of motor skills are important for overall physical coordination and performance of various tasks in daily life.
